What is Mold?
Mold is a type of fungus that grows in damp and humid conditions. It can grow on any surface, including walls, ceilings, floors, and fabrics. Mold spores can spread easily and cause health problems such as allergies, respiratory problems, and skin irritation.
How to Identify Mold on Walls
There are some signs that can help you identify mold on walls. These include:
- Black, green, or white spots on walls
- A musty smell
- Peeling or discolored paint
- Damp or humid walls
- Water stains
How to Remove Mold from Walls
Here are some steps that you can follow to remove mold from walls:
- Wear protective gear such as gloves, goggles, and a mask.
- Identify the source of moisture and fix it to prevent mold from growing back.
- Use a scraper or a brush to remove the mold from the wall. Make sure to dispose of the mold carefully.
- Use a mold-killing solution to clean the affected area. You can use a mixture of bleach and water or a commercial mold remover.
- Scrub the affected area with the solution and let it sit for 10-15 minutes.
- Rinse the area with clean water and dry it thoroughly.
- Repeat the process if necessary.
Preventing Mold Growth
Here are some tips to prevent mold growth on walls:
- Keep your home well-ventilated and dry.
- Fix any leaks or water damage promptly.
- Clean and dry any wet or damp areas immediately.
- Use a dehumidifier to reduce moisture levels.
- Regularly clean and maintain your HVAC system.
FAQs
How can I tell if there is mold behind my walls?
You can look for signs such as a musty smell, peeling paint, or damp walls. However, the best way to determine if there is mold behind your walls is to hire a professional to perform a mold inspection.
Is bleach an effective mold remover?
Yes, bleach can be an effective mold remover. However, it is important to use it properly and in the correct concentration to avoid damaging your walls or surfaces.
Can I paint over mold on walls?
No, it is not recommended to paint over mold on walls. The mold will continue to grow and spread underneath the paint, and it can cause health problems and damage to your property.
